I just noticed yesterday that when I engage my 4WD Lever on my Cab tractor that it is not lighting up on the dashboard.

The Tractor is engaging 4WD, and the actual Lightbulb does work, because when I turn the machine on it lights up for 3 seconds along with all of the other dashboard light indicators.

It's not a big deal, just wondering if anybody knows what might be a quick fix to remedy this.

The MFWD light is activitated by a switch. Check that the harness attached to the switch isn't damaged or disconnnected. The switch should be on the left side of the transmission under the footdeck. Look for the lever on the transmission that moves when the MFWD is turned on and off and there should be a switch near by (probably above the lever).
